How much do vp semiconductor j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for vp semiconductor in the United States is $157,532.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$115,000.00 and $190,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a VP of Semiconductor do?

A VP of Semiconductor is a senior executive responsible for overseeing the strategy, operations, and business growth of a semiconductor company or division. They manage teams across engineering, manufacturing, sales, and product development to ensure the successful design and production of semiconductor products like chips and integrated circuits. The role involves setting long-term vision, building partnerships, ensuring supply chain efficiency, and driving innovation to stay competitive in the fast-evolving technology sector.

Title: Vice President of Products 

Company: Mattson Technology, Inc., a 38-year Silicon Valley company, designs, manufactures, markets, and globally supports plasma and rapid thermal processing equipment to fabricate integrated circuits for the global semiconductor industry. 

Mattson Technology, Inc. offers processing equipment that utilizes innovative technologies to deliver advanced processing capabilities and high productivity for the fabrication of current and next-generation integrated circuits. Our equipment and technologies are used by leading memory and logic, analog /power device manufacturers worldwide. Innovations from Mattson Technology in Atomic Surface Engineeringaddress the most critical logic and memory manufacturing challenges. 

In May 2016, Mattson Technology was acquired by Beijing's E-Town Capital. Our new investor's vision is that Mattson Technology, with its Silicon Valley DNA, will continue to operate as a global, market-driven technology provider serving worldwide semiconductor manufacturing customers. In July, 2025, the company successfully listed in Shanghai's STAR Exchange. As the external trade compliance environment evolves, Mattson Technology now operates independently from the parent company in product, business, and operations, serving customers outside of China.
